Comprehending what drives the need for switchboard upgrades requires a look at how drastically electrical power intake has changed over the past couple of decades. When much of Sydney's older homes and commercial buildings were built, the typical family drew power for lighting, a fridge, maybe a tv, and a handful of smaller sized appliances. The switchboards installed throughout that age were calibrated for that modest demand. Fast forward to the present, and a single family might concurrently run ducted air conditioning, multiple computer systems, a dishwashing machine, washing machine, dryer, clever home devices, and a suite of kitchen area appliances-- all without a doubt. Commercial properties deal with even higher need pressures. Switchboard upgrades address this inequality straight by changing outdated facilities with contemporary parts that can deal with modern load requirements securely and effectively. Without this intervention, overloaded circuits develop heat, heat deteriorates circuitry insulation, and broken down insulation ends up being the beginning point for electrical fires that can damage properties and claim lives.
A well‑done switchboard upgrade differs from a basic repair by the breadth of enhancements it brings to every element of your electrical wiring system. Contemporary switchboards come fitted with residual‑current devices-- often called safety switches-- that area irregular existing flow and shut down power in a split‑second, quickly enough to avert electrocution if someone contacts a live part. On the other hand, website older panels that rely on ceramic merges lack this secure. The breaker included during an upgrade likewise react far more rapidly and dependably than older models, opening cleanly when a circuit is strained instead of permitting hazardous currents to stick around. In New South Wales, electrical security codes mandate that modern-day switchboards accomplish certain requirements, and a certified electrician performing the upgrade will ensure full compliance. For owners, this isn't simply paperwork; it straight impacts insurance coverage eligibility and liability ought to a mishap occur.

Deciding to move on with switchboard upgrades starts with an expert evaluation from a licensed electrician who can assess your existing board's condition, identify any deficiencies, and draw up the scope of work needed. Warning signs that suggest urgent attention consist of ceramic merges still in use, a board that feels warm to the touch, circuits that trip consistently under regular load, discolouration or burn marks around the panel, and any switchboard that has actually not been examined in over a decade. As soon as the assessment is complete, a qualified electrician will carry out the complete upgrade with very little interruption, leaving your residential or commercial property with a safe, certified, and future-ready electrical system.
